Bio Background
This gene encodes a type II transmembrane glycoproteinbelonging to the M28 peptidase family. The protein acts as aglutamate carboxypeptidase on different alternative substrates, including the nutrient folate and the neuropeptideN-acetyl-l-aspartyl-l-glutamate and is expressed in a number oftissues such as prostate, central and peripheral nervous system andkidney. A mutation in this gene may be associated with impairedintestinal absorption of dietary folates, resulting in low bloodfolate levels and consequent hyperhomocysteinemia. Expression ofthis protein in the brain may be involved in a number ofpathological conditions associated with glutamate excitotoxicity.In the prostate the protein is up-regulated in cancerous cells andis used as an effective diagnostic and prognostic indicator ofprostate cancer. This gene likely arose from a duplication event ofa nearby chromosomal region. Alternative splicing gives rise tomultiple transcript variants encoding several different isoforms.
